Lines Matching refs:ec
49 static int cros_ec_pkt_xfer_lpc(struct cros_ec_device *ec, in cros_ec_pkt_xfer_lpc() argument
59 ret = cros_ec_prepare_tx(ec, msg); in cros_ec_pkt_xfer_lpc()
63 outb(ec->dout[i], EC_LPC_ADDR_HOST_PACKET + i); in cros_ec_pkt_xfer_lpc()
65 request = (struct ec_host_request *)ec->dout; in cros_ec_pkt_xfer_lpc()
71 dev_warn(ec->dev, "EC responsed timed out\n"); in cros_ec_pkt_xfer_lpc()
78 ret = cros_ec_check_result(ec, msg); in cros_ec_pkt_xfer_lpc()
92 dev_err(ec->dev, in cros_ec_pkt_xfer_lpc()
107 dev_err(ec->dev, in cros_ec_pkt_xfer_lpc()
120 static int cros_ec_cmd_xfer_lpc(struct cros_ec_device *ec, in cros_ec_cmd_xfer_lpc() argument
130 dev_err(ec->dev, in cros_ec_cmd_xfer_lpc()
162 dev_warn(ec->dev, "EC responsed timed out\n"); in cros_ec_cmd_xfer_lpc()
169 ret = cros_ec_check_result(ec, msg); in cros_ec_cmd_xfer_lpc()
180 dev_err(ec->dev, in cros_ec_cmd_xfer_lpc()
199 dev_err(ec->dev, in cros_ec_cmd_xfer_lpc()
213 static int cros_ec_lpc_readmem(struct cros_ec_device *ec, unsigned int offset, in cros_ec_lpc_readmem() argument